/*Css Document By:millia At 2021-12-21 08:53:36 */
@import url("http://www.jiaodong.net/inc/millia/millia.css");
@import url("http://www.jiaodong.net/inc/millia/swiper3.4.2.css");
#millia{background:url(images/topic.jpg) no-repeat top center;padding-top:920px;}
.millia{width:1200px;margin:0 auto;}
.whiteBg{background:#fff;padding:25px;box-sizing:border-box;}

.focus .swiper-slide{width:100%;height:440px;overflow:hidden;position:relative;}
.focus .swiper-slide b{display:block;width:100%;font-size:20px;line-height:54px;font-weight:normal;color:#fff;position:absolute;left:0;bottom:0;background:rgba(0,0,0,.6);text-indent:20px;}
.focus .swiper-pagination{left:auto;bottom:15px;right:10px;width:auto;}
.focus .swiper-pagination-bullet{background:#fff;opacity:1;margin:0 5px !important;width:10px;height:10px;border-radius:5px;}
.focus .swiper-pagination-bullet-active{background:#fccf5a;width:30px;}
.focus .swiper-slide img,.ls02 li img,.poster .swiper-slide img,.bigImg .swiper-slide img{width:100%;height:100%;transition:all .5s;}
.focus .swiper-slide:hover img,.ls02 li:hover img{transform:scale(1.2,1.2);}

.ls01 dt{font-size:22px;font-weight:bold;padding:20px 0 15px 0;margin-top:20px;border-top:1px dotted #c6ccd0;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
.ls01 dt:first-child{padding-top:0;border:none;margin:0;}
.ls01 dd{font-size:18px;line-height:38px;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;padding-left:15px;position:relative;}
.ls01 dd:before{content:"";display:block;position:absolute;left:0;top:50%;width:4px;height:4px;background:#ea2830;margin-top:-2px;}

.bg01{background:url(images/bg01.jpg) no-repeat center center;}
.bg02{background:url(images/bg02.jpg) no-repeat center bottom;}
.bg03{background:url(images/bg03.jpg) #fccf5a no-repeat center top;padding:60px 0 40px 0;}
.tabs{display:flex;justify-content:space-between;}
.tabs li{width:14.2%;background:#ffe193;padding:20px 0;border-radius:10px 10px 0 0;text-align:center;font-size:20px;display:flex;align-items:center;justify-content:center;}
.tabs li.active{background:#fccf5a;font-weight:bold;}
.tabs a:hover{text-decoration:none;}

.ls02,.ls03{display:flex;justify-content:space-between;flex-wrap:wrap;background:#f0f0f0;padding:15px 10px 25px 10px;}
.ls03{padding:40px 10px 20px 10px;}
.ls02 li,.ls03 li{width:19.5%;height:180px;overflow:hidden;margin-top:10px;}

.ht01{position:relative;text-align:center;padding:40px 0;z-index:9;}
.ht01:after{content:"";display:block;position:absolute;left:0;bottom:-30px;background:url(images/htbg.png) no-repeat bottom center;height:73px;width:100%;}
.ht01 b{display:inline-block;background:#e84324;font-size:36px;color:#fff;padding:10px 30px;border-radius:40px;font-weight:normal;}
.ht01 b svg{color:#fff;width:auto;height:32px;margin-right:20px;}

.ls04{display:flex;justify-content:space-between;}
.ls04 li{width:32%;height:700px;overflow:hidden;}

.drawing{width:100% !important;height:475px !important;overflow:hidden;position:relative;}
.bgImg{visibility:visible;position:absolute;left:-1000px;top:-600px;cursor:move;}

.bigImg .swiper-slide{width:100%;height:760px;overflow:hidden;position:relative;}
.bigImg .swiper-slide p{background:rgba(0,0,0,0.5);padding:20px;position:absolute;color:#fff;z-index:5;bottom:10%;right:-10000%;width:36%;box-sizing:border-box;font-size:18px;line-height:36px;transition:all 1s;}
.bigImg .swiper-slide p b{display:block;font-size:24px;padding-bottom:20px;}
.bigImg .swiper-slide-active p{right:10%;}


@media screen and (max-width:640px) {
#millia{background-size:130% auto;padding-top:24rem;}
.millia{width:96%;}
.whiteBg{padding:2rem 1rem;}
.ls01 dt{font-size:1.6rem;}
.ls01 dd{font-size:1.4rem;line-height:2.8rem;}

.focus .swiper-slide,.bigImg .swiper-slide{width:100% !important;height:auto !important;}
.focus .swiper-slide b{white-space:nowrap;overflow:hidden;text-indent:0;font-size:1.4rem;line-height:2.6rem;text-align:center;}
.focus .swiper-pagination,.poster .swiper-pagination,.bigImg .swiper-slide p{display:none;}

.tabs li{font-size:1.3rem;padding:1rem 0.5rem;box-sizing:border-box;}
.ls02 li,.ls03 li{width:49%;height:13rem;}
.ht01{padding:2rem 0;}
.ht01 b{font-size:1.6rem;}
.ht01 b svg{height:1.6rem;margin-right:1rem;}
.ht01:after{background-size:auto 100%;height:4rem;bottom:-2rem;}


}
